| Beschrijving keerzijde | A finely detailed profile view of the French PLM (Paris-Lyon-Méditerranée) Pacific-type steam locomotive dominates the central field, depicted in three-quarter perspective travelling along railway tracks that recede toward the lower portion of the coin. The locomotive is rendered with meticulous mechanical detail, including large driving wheels, boiler, and streamlined cab. A scenic landscape background features bare trees and rolling terrain beneath a stippled night sky. The curved legend LEGENDS OF THE RAILS - PLM PACIFIC arcs around the upper periphery, while the denomination 20 DOLLARS is inscribed along the lower margin. |

| Aanvullende informatie |
The Pacific Life Medals (PLM) series, produced for Liberia in the early 2000s, was part of a broader wave of foreign-licensed commemorative programs that exploited Liberia's open coinage laws — the country had long permitted private minting houses, primarily in Germany and Austria, to strike legal tender issues with no meaningful connection to Liberian commerce or circulation. These coins were sold wholesale into the collector market, never touching West African soil.
